Detecting dissociations in single-case studies: Type I errors, statistical power and the classical versus strong
John R Crawford1, Paul H Garthwaite
1School of Psychology, College of Life Sciences and Medicine, King's College, University of Aberdeen, Aberdeen AB24 2UB, UK. j.crawford@abdn.ac.uk
Neuropsychology
Area of Science:
- Neuropsychology
- Cognitive Neuroscience
- Psychology
Background:
- Single-case studies are crucial for neuropsychological theory development.
- Empirical validation of dissociation criteria is essential.
- Existing methods for identifying dissociations require scrutiny.
Purpose of the Study:
- To empirically examine the Type I error rates of two methods for detecting strong dissociations.
- To evaluate the power of these methods in identifying dissociations.
- To question the practical utility of the strong versus classical dissociation distinction.
Main Methods:
- Monte Carlo simulations were employed to extend previous work on classical dissociations.
- Two methods for detecting strong dissociations were analyzed.
- Type I error rates were assessed under different misclassification definitions.
Main Results:
- When misclassifying healthy controls, Type I error rates were low for both methods.
- High Type I error rates were observed when misclassifying patients with equivalent deficits.
- The distinction between strong and classical dissociations showed questionable practical utility.
Conclusions:
- Current criteria for strong dissociations may lead to high error rates.
- The power to detect dissociations varies depending on the definition used.
- The practical value of differentiating between strong and classical dissociations is uncertain.
